In Kenya, an array of vibrant business companies operate in various sectors, contributing significantly to the country's economy. These companies often rely on debt and loans to finance their operations, expand their reach, and drive growth. However, managing debt and loans effectively is crucial for their long-term sustainability and success. Debt can be a useful tool for business companies in Kenya, helping them to fund investments and smooth out cash flow fluctuations. Whether it is through bank loans, bonds, or other forms of financing, debt can provide the necessary capital to fuel growth and seize opportunities. However, excessive debt can also pose risks, leading to financial instability and potential insolvency. To navigate debt successfully, Kenyan business companies must carefully evaluate their borrowing needs, assess their ability to repay, and consider the cost of debt. It is essential to strike a balance between leveraging debt for growth and managing the associated risks. Engaging with financial advisors and conducting thorough financial analysis can help companies make informed decisions about taking on debt. In addition to debt, businesses in Kenya often utilize loans to meet their short-term and long-term financing needs. Whether it is a working capital loan to cover operational expenses or a term loan for capital expenditures, borrowing is a common practice among Kenyan companies. Loans can offer flexibility and convenience, allowing businesses to access funds quickly and efficiently. When considering loans, business companies in Kenya should shop around for the best terms and interest rates, considering factors such as repayment schedules, collateral requirements, and loan covenants. Understanding the terms of the loan agreement and ensuring the business's ability to service the debt are essential steps in responsible borrowing. Overall, managing debt and loans is a critical aspect of running a successful business in Kenya.
